The average estimated car insurance premium for a 2017 Chevrolet Spark is $1,548 per year, or about $129 per month. This is based on a 40-year-old male driver with no prior driving violations or at-fault accidents. Comprehensive and collision deductibles are $500 and Uninsured and Underinsured Motorist (UM/UIM) coverage is included.

Insurance Rates by Driver Age

The table below shows average car insurance rates for the 2017 Chevrolet Spark for different driver ages.

2017 Chevrolet Spark Insurance Cost for Drivers Aged 16 to 80
Driver Age Annual Premium Cost Per Month
16$5,782$482
17$5,491$458
18$4,714$393
19$4,374$365
20$3,299$275
21$3,146$262
22$2,787$232
23$2,367$197
24$2,204$184
25$1,786$149
30$1,630$136
35$1,598$133
40$1,548$129
45$1,466$122
50$1,396$116
55$1,304$109
60$1,304$109
65$1,382$115
70$1,536$128
75$1,858$155
80$2,296$191

Data Methodology: Rated driver is male and has no driving violations or at-fault accidents in the prior three years. Comprehensive and collision deductibles are $500. Uninsured Motorist (UM), Underinsured Motorist (UIM) and medical payments coverages are included. Drivers under the age of 25 are considered single, while drivers 25 and over are rated as married. Annual premium is averaged for all Chevrolet Spark trim levels.
